How does Nobilis Hampden No. 14 <>H 2013 taste?

Aggregated from 62 community reviews.

Explosive, balanced high‑ester fruit bomb For seasoned enthusiasts: a cask‑strength, high‑ester Hampden that explodes with overripe tropical fruit, glue/solvent funk, marzipan and young oak. RumX members praise its balance, powerful nose and outstanding alcohol integration across 62 reviews.

Perfect for

Fans of high‑ester Jamaican funk who enjoy powerful, fruity Hampdens at full cask strength and want one of the standout 2013 single casks with great balance and integration.

Less suitable for

Those sensitive to very high ABV, beginners new to Jamaican funk, or drinkers who prefer soft, sweet, low‑intensity rums without solventy ester notes.

Review by Galli33

Galli33
Dec 2022478 reviewsItaly
9.0/10

Very delicious, complex, elegant Rum with all the lovely smells and tastes a Hampden Rum can/must have. Nose: Wunderfull notes of ester, glue, nail polish, fruity, grilled pineapple, mango, sour. Mouth: dry, funky, a bit astringend, delicious, complex, fruity, pineapple, banana, mango, papaya, citrus, young wood, barrel, vanilla, toasted Finish: long and delicious with notes of ester, young wood, roasted, espresso, pineapple and olives

Review by Basti

Mar 2025485 reviewsGermany
8.9/10

Ester, glue, pineapple, mango, citrus and fermented fruit on the nose. Intense and creamy/oily on the palate with lots of ripe and overripe fruit, glue. Overall, the ester/gluten notes are very present here. The finish is very long. Alcohol is also perfectly integrated.
